Output 1267741897fb4be163a441830e7fc52cc4f31a07c01fc6a401bb2f602ea7b843:3

value
2198017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d606570918eb10f251f8285faea2b173e61dba OP_EQUAL
address
MFTA2rvzYLCjyTGcnb8HSprG9aYqvZy9wc
transaction
1267741897fb4be163a441830e7fc52cc4f31a07c01fc6a401bb2f602ea7b843
spent
true